.elementor-30474 .elementor-element.elementor-element-b4ad729{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--align-items:center;}.elementor-30474 .elementor-element.elementor-element-770b367 .elementor-icon-wrapper{text-align:center;}.elementor-30474 .elementor-element.elementor-element-770b367.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-accent );}.elementor-30474 .elementor-element.elementor-element-770b367.elementor-view-framed .elementor-icon, .elementor-30474 .elementor-element.elementor-element-770b367.elementor-view-default .elementor-icon{color:var( --e-global-color-accent );border-color:var( --e-global-color-accent );}.elementor-30474 .elementor-element.elementor-element-770b367.elementor-view-framed .elementor-icon, .elementor-30474 .elementor-element.elementor-element-770b367.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-accent );}.el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-title, .el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-title a{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-size:var( --e-global-typography-accent-font-size );font-weight:var( --e-global-typography-accent-font-weight );}.el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);}.jet-listing-item.single-jet-engine.elementor-page-30474 > .elementor{width:300px;margin-left:auto;margin-right:auto;}@media(max-width:1024px){.el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-title, .el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-title a{font-size:var( --e-global-typography-accent-font-size );}.el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);}}@media(max-width:767px){.elementor-30474 .elementor-element.elementor-element-b4ad729{--content-width:100%;--min-height:215px;}.el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-title, .el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-title a{font-size:var( --e-global-typography-accent-font-size );}.elementor-30474 .elementor-element.elementor-element-e49dbfb .elementor-icon-box-description{font-size:var( --e-global-typography-text-font-size );}}/* Start custom CSS for container, class: .elementor-element-b4ad729 *//* ===== Premium Feature Box ===== */
.feature-box{
  position: relative;
  padding: 32px 28px;
  border-radius: 18px;
  background: linear-gradient(
    180deg,
    rgba(255,255,255,.05),
    rgba(255,255,255,.02)
  );
  border: 1px solid rgba(255,255,255,.10);
  box-shadow: 0 18px 55px rgba(0,0,0,.55);
  transition: transform .25s ease, box-shadow .25s ease, border-color .25s ease;
  overflow: hidden;
}

/* افکت هاور */
.feature-box:hover{
  transform: translateY(-6px);
  border-color: rgba(255,255,255,.25);
  box-shadow: 0 28px 80px rgba(0,0,0,.65);
}

/* Glow بسیار ظریف */
.feature-box::before{
  content:"";
  position:absolute;
  inset:-1px;
  background: radial-gradient(
    circle at top right,
    rgba(255,255,255,.18),
    transparent 55%
  );
  opacity: .45;
  pointer-events:none;
}/* End custom CSS */